RICHARD CLEARKE,  Will 1 August 1585

RICHARD CLEARKE of the parishe of Seele in Kent yeoman 1 August 1585, being aged and sickly etc. To be buried in the churchyeard of Seele. To the reparacons of the church of Seele 3s. 4d. To the poore of the said parishe at my buriall 10s. Rest vnto John Clearke my sonne my sole executor. Last Will: of my house and landes. Vnto John Clarke my sonne all that my mansion house and all my landes in the parishe of Seele vppon condicon that he paie vnto Thomas Clearke my sonne £10 that is 40s. euery yeare vntill £10 be fully paide (with power of entry in default). Witnesses: Gilbert Jenyns, clarke, Richard Blage and Robert Velsat. 
Proved 25 June 1589 in the parish church of Sevenocke in the Metropolitical Visitation of John Whitgift Archbishop 1589 by executor and Gilbert Jenyns clerk. (262a Whitgift I).
